Postcode KT13 9ZA is located in a major urban area, within the Oatlands and Burwood Park ward of Elmbridge in the South East region, and forms part of the Oatlands area. It has very low deprivation and low crime levels, with around 40.6 crimes per 1,000 residents per year, about 52% below the South East average of 84 per 1,000. The average income per household in Oatlands is £85,742 per year. The nearest station is Weybridge, about 1.1 miles away. There are 5 primary and no secondary schools in the area.
Oatlands has a very low level of deprivation, ranked at position 29,284 out of 32,844 areas in the United Kingdom, placing it within the bottom 11% least deprived areas in England.

Approximately 2.9% of homes on this street are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. Across the surrounding area, around 4.9% of dwellings are socially rented.
